Choosing the right mechanism and drive

Different applications demand different vertical transportation methods. A vertical reciprocating platform might suit compact spaces, while a scissor lift delivers solid payload options for service floors. Hydraulic drives provide smooth operation for continuous cycles, and traction systems can extend duty life in busy facilities. The selection process weighs installation complexity, energy efficiency, and control fidelity. By prioritizing reliability and maintainability, teams choose mechanisms that support long-term operation without compromising safety or user experience, keeping lines of sight and accessibility in mind for every user.

Safety, compliance, and user experience

Regulatory compliance and robust safety features are non negotiable in lift design. Lockout mechanisms, emergency lowers, load sensors, and redundant controls reduce risk while promoting confidence among operators and maintenance staff. Clear signaling, intuitive interfaces, and accessible cabin layouts improve usability for a diverse audience. Training, routine inspections, and preventive maintenance plans ensure ongoing safety and performance. Integrating safety considerations early helps avoid costly retrofits and supports consistent user satisfaction across all shifts and roles.

Installation planning and project management

Effective implementation hinges on a well-structured project plan that coordinates design, fabrication, site preparation, and testing. Stakeholders monitor milestones, align procurement with production schedules, and minimize disruption to daily operations. Onsite commissioning verifies system integration with power, safety systems, and building controls. A phased handover includes documentation, training, and performance benchmarks. This disciplined approach reduces the risk of delays and ensures a smooth transition from concept to fully functional equipment that enhances accessibility and workflow efficiency.
